CrossFit's own methodology page describes the training as constantly varied functional movements performed at high intensity. That variety is the nutritional problem: a heavy strength day, a 20-minute metabolic conditioning piece and a long partner workout place very different demands on the same athlete in the same week. The practical answer is to keep protein and total energy steady, and move carbohydrate up on the hardest days. It is also worth knowing that a systematic review of high-intensity functional training found the nutrition-intervention evidence in this population to be limited and generally low-to-moderate quality.
The official CrossFit methodology centres on constantly varied functional movements at high intensity — that is the organisation's own framing, not a research finding, and the two should not be blurred together.
Independent work is more measured. A systematic review of CrossFit and high-intensity functional training describes substantial mixed aerobic and anaerobic metabolic stress, which is what the day-to-day experience of the sport suggests: efforts short enough to be glycolytic, repeated often enough to also tax aerobic systems.
A week can contain maximal strength work, gymnastics volume, and metabolic conditioning of wildly different durations.
Repeated glycolytic efforts draw on muscle glycogen, so low-carbohydrate days tend to show up first in the metcon, not the lift.
Class timing (early morning or straight after work) drives most people's real-world nutrition problems more than macros do.
Competition weekends stack multiple events per day and turn recovery between sessions into the main event.
For protein, the general exercise literature is far stronger. The ISSN position stand puts a sufficient daily intake for most exercising people at roughly 1.4–2.0 g per kg per day, and Morton and colleagues' meta-analysis found that added protein improves strength and lean-mass gains from resistance training, with the pooled benefit levelling off near 1.6 g/kg/day.
For the conditioning side, carbohydrate availability is the consensus lever in endurance and high-intensity work (PMID 42070893).
How strong is this evidence? Be sceptical of confident CrossFit macro prescriptions, including branded 'blocks' and fixed ratios. The sport-specific evidence base is small and mostly low-to-moderate quality; the reliable parts of this page are borrowed from broader protein and carbohydrate research.
Early-morning athletes often train on little or nothing and are fine. If you train later, aim for a normal mixed meal two to three hours out.
Keep fat and fibre moderate before anything with a lot of inversion, running or high-rep barbell work.
After class
Protein plus carbohydrate, ideally as an actual meal rather than a shake plus nothing.

Rest and active-recovery days
Keep protein steady. Reduce the carbohydrate-dense sides rather than cutting whole meals.
Use rest days for higher-fibre, more vegetable-forward eating.
Competition days
Multiple events mean multiple small, familiar, easily digested feeds rather than two big meals.
Plan the day around the heat schedule, and rehearse it at a local throwdown before it matters.

Where gluten-free actually fits
Our kitchen has been 100% dedicated gluten-free since 2017, which is genuinely useful if you have coeliac disease or gluten sensitivity and are tired of cross-contamination disclaimers on meal-prep menus. It should not be sold as a performance edge: for athletes without a medical or individual reason to avoid gluten, going gluten-free does not improve recovery, reduce inflammation or add watts.
Frequently asked questions
What is the best meal prep for CrossFit?
The one you will actually eat on the days you train hard. Practically that means a repeatable protein source at every meal, carbohydrate concentrated around your hardest sessions, and food that is ready when you walk out of the gym rather than 40 minutes of cooking away.
How much protein do CrossFit athletes need?
General research for exercising people points to roughly 1.4–2.0 g per kg of body weight per day, with resistance-training benefits levelling off around 1.6 g/kg/day in pooled analyses. There is no CrossFit-specific number worth trusting beyond that.
Should I eat low carb for CrossFit?
Repeated high-intensity efforts rely heavily on muscle glycogen, so low-carbohydrate eating tends to be felt most in metabolic conditioning. If you want to try it, do it in an off-season block and with professional guidance rather than before a competition.
Do I need to eat before a 6am class?
Not necessarily. Plenty of athletes train fasted early and eat immediately afterwards without issue. If you feel flat or light-headed in longer morning pieces, a small carbohydrate-containing snack beforehand is the first thing to test.
